KOMWB_MATCHING_HEADER_MAINTAIN SAP (Trading Contract: Contract Matching Header data for update) Structure details

Dictionary Type: Structure
Description: Trading Contract: Contract Matching Header data for update




ABAP Code to SELECT data from KOMWB_MATCHING_HEADER_MAINTAIN
Related tables to KOMWB_MATCHING_HEADER_MAINTAIN
Access table KOMWB_MATCHING_HEADER_MAINTAIN




Structure field list including key, data, relationships and ABAP select examples

KOMWB_MATCHING_HEADER_MAINTAIN is a standard SAP Structure so does not store data like a database table does. It can be used to define the fields of other actual tables or to process "Trading Contract: Contract Matching Header data for update" Information within sap ABAP programs.

This is done by declaring abap internal tables, work areas or database tables based on this Structure. These can then be used to store and process the required data appropriately.

i.e. DATA: wa_KOMWB_MATCHING_HEADER_MAINTAIN TYPE KOMWB_MATCHING_HEADER_MAINTAIN.

The KOMWB_MATCHING_HEADER_MAINTAIN table consists of various fields, each holding specific information or linking keys about Trading Contract: Contract Matching Header data for update data available in SAP. These include TCTYP_TO (Trading Contract Type of Target Document), TKONN (Trading Contract: Trading Contract Number), TKONN_EX (Trading Contract: External Document Number), BTBSTA (Trading Contract: Application Status).. See below for full list along with technical details, documentation, text table, check tables, foreign key relationships, conversion routines, relevant tcodes and example ABAP select code etc. .

Delivery Class:
Display/Maintenance via tcode SM30: Display/Maintenance Allowed but with Restrictions
SAP enhancement categories: Can be enhanced (character-type or numeric)


SAP KOMWB_MATCHING_HEADER_MAINTAIN structure fields - Full list of fields found in SAP data dictionary

Field Description Data Element Data Type length (Dec) Check table Conversion Routine Domain Name MemoryID SHLP
MATCHING_INTERNAL_IDGUID in 'CHAR' format with upper-/lowercase (!) GUID_22CHAR22SYSUUID_22
TCTYP_TOTrading Contract Type of Target Document WB2_TCTYP_TOCHAR4TB2BETCTYP
TKONNTrading Contract: Trading Contract Number TKONNCHAR10Assigned to domainALPHATKONNWKNWBHK
TKONN_EXTrading Contract: External Document Number TKONN_EXCHAR30TKONN_EXWKN_EX
BTBSTATrading Contract: Application Status BTBSTACHAR1Assigned to domainBTBSTA
KUNNRSold-to party KUNAGCHAR10Assigned to domainALPHAKUNNRVAG
ERNAMName of Person who Created the Object ERNAMCHAR12USNAM
ERDATDate on Which Record Was Created ERDATDATS8DATUM
ERZEITTime, at Which Record Was Added ERZEITTIMS6UHRZT
AENAMName of Person Who Changed Object AENAMCHAR12USNAM
AEDATChanged On AEDATDATS8DATUM
AEZEITTime of Change AEZEITTIMS6UHRZT
TKSACHBTrading Contract: Person Responsible TKSACHBCHAR12UNAME
TKWAERSTrading Contract: Currency of Trading Contract TKWAERSCUKY5TCURCWAERS
TKRATEExchange Rate for Price Determination KURSKDEC9(5) EXCRTKURRF
KURSTExchange Rate Type KURSTCHAR4TCURVKURSTKUT
BUDATPosting Date in the Document BUDATDATS8DATUM
KVEWEUsage of the condition table KVEWECHAR1T681VKVEWEKVW
KAPPLApplication KAPPLCHAR2T681AKAPPLKAP
KSCHLCondition Type KSCHLCHAR4T685KSCHLVKS
KAWRTCondition base value KAWRTCURR15(2) WERTV8
KBETRRate (condition amount or percentage) KBETRCURR11(2) WERTV6
KWERTCondition value KWERTCURR13(2) WERTV7
WAERSCurrency Key WAERSCUKY5TCURCWAERSFWS
AUGRUOrder reason (reason for the business transaction) AUGRUCHAR3TVAUAUGRU
ABSSCPayment guarantee procedure ABSSCHE_CMCHAR6T691MABSSCHE_CM
AUDATDocument Date (Date Received/Sent) AUDATDATS8DATUM
KURRFExchange rate for FI postings KURRFDEC9(5) KURRF
ELIFNVendor Account Number ELIFNCHAR10LFA1ALPHALIFNRLIFKRED_C
TEW_TYPETrading Execution Workbench Type WB2_TEW_TYPECHAR4WB2_TEW_TYPETEW_TYPE2S_TEWTYPE
VKORGSales Organization VKORGCHAR4Assigned to domainVKORGVKOC_VKORG
VTWEGDistribution Channel VTWEGCHAR2Assigned to domainVTWEGVTWC_VTWEG
SPARTDivision SPARTCHAR2Assigned to domainSPARTSPAC_SPART
VKGRPSales Group VKGRPCHAR3TVBVKVKGRPVKG
VKBURSales Office VKBURCHAR4TVKBZVKBURVKB
EKORGPurchasing Organization EKORGCHAR4T024EEKORGEKO
EKGRPPurchasing Group EKGRPCHAR3T024EKGRPEKG
EBDATPurchasing Document Date EBDATDATS8DATUM
NETWR_SDNet Value of the Sales Order in Document Currency NETWR_AKCURR15(2) WERTV8
SDWRSSD Document Currency WAERKCUKY5Assigned to domainWAERSFWS
TKRATE_SDGT Exchange Rate Sales Order Currency / Local Currency TKRATE_SDDEC9(5) EXCRTKURRF
KURST_SDExchange Rate Type KURSTCHAR4TCURVKURSTKUT
PRSDT_SDDate for pricing and exchange rate PRSDTDATS8DATUM
NETWR_MMNet Value in Document Currency NETWRCURR15(2) WERTV8
WAERS_PURCHCurrency Key WAERSCUKY5TCURCWAERSFWS
TKRATE_MMGT Exchange Rate Order Currency / Local Currency TKRATE_MMDEC9(5) EXCRTKURRF
KURST_MMExchange Rate Type KURSTCHAR4TCURVKURSTKUT
TC_RELEASEDRelease Status for Follow-On Document Generation TC_RELEASEDCHAR1TC_RELEASED
COMPANY_CODECompany Code BUKRSCHAR4T001BUKRSBUKC_T001
SET_VARIANTBusiness Process Variant for Contract Settlement WB2_WASHOUT_SET_VARIANTCHAR1WB2_WASHOUT_SET_VARIANT
SETT_MODEContract Settlement: Settlement Mode of the item WB2_SETT_MODECHAR1WB2_SETT_MODE
SETT_STATUSContract Settlement Status WB2_SETT_STATUSCHAR1WB2_SETT_STATUS
STATGRTrading Contract: Status Group STATGRCHAR1Assigned to domainSTATGR
COMPLETETrading Contract: Document is Complete HKCOMCHAR1FLAG
QUAN_COMPLETETrading Contract: Quantities In Document Are Complete HKCOM_QUANCHAR1FLAG
UPDKZUpdate indicator UPDKZ_DCHAR1UPDKZ
BEZEI_TCTYPName of Trading Contract Type TCTYP_BEZCHAR40TEXT40
BEZEI_KUNNRAddress Line WLF_LINESCHAR80LINES
BEZEI_LIFNRAddress Line WLF_LINESCHAR80LINES
BEZEI_STATUSTrading Contract: Name of Application Status BTBSTA_BEZCHAR40TEXT40
AMPEL_STATUSStatus of Item AMPELCHAR30CHAR30
VTEXT_KSCHLName VTXTKCHAR20TEXT20
BEZEI_CURTLong Text LTEXTCHAR40TEXT40
BEZEI_VKORGDescription of sales organization VKORG_BEZCHAR20TEXT20
BEZEI_VTWEGDescription of distribution channel VTWEG_BEZCHAR20TEXT20
BEZEI_SPARTDescription of division SPART_BEZCHAR20TEXT20
TXT_VTRBERSales area TXT_VTRBERCHAR64TXT_VTRBER
BEZEI_VKBURDescription of sales office VKBUR_BEZCHAR20TEXT20
BEZEI_VKGRPDescription of Sales Group VKGRP_BEZCHAR20TEXT20
BEZEI_EKORGDescription of Purchasing Organization EKOTXCHAR20TEXT20
BEZEI_EKGRPDescription of purchasing group EKNAMCHAR18TEXT18
BEZEI_CURT_SDLong Text LTEXTCHAR40TEXT40
BEZEI_CURT_MMLong Text LTEXTCHAR40TEXT40

Key field Non-key field



How do I retrieve data from SAP structure KOMWB_MATCHING_HEADER_MAINTAIN using ABAP code?

As KOMWB_MATCHING_HEADER_MAINTAIN is a database structure and not a table it does not store any data in the SAP data dictionary. The ABAP SELECT statement is therefore not appropriate and can not be performed on KOMWB_MATCHING_HEADER_MAINTAIN as there is no data to select.

How to access SAP table KOMWB_MATCHING_HEADER_MAINTAIN

Within an ECC or HANA version of SAP you can also view further information about KOMWB_MATCHING_HEADER_MAINTAIN and the data within it using relevant transactions such as

SE11 (ABAP Dictionary Maintenance)
SM30 (Maintain Table Data)
SE80 (Object Navigator)
SE16 (Data Browser).


Search for further information about these or an SAP related objects



Comments on this SAP object

What made you want to lookup this SAP object? Please tell us what you were looking for and anything you would like to be included on this page!